USER INFORMATION
Make the stencil as required. Dry the screen thoroughly.
Mixing ratio 1 : 1 : 2 by volume (Patly A : Patly B : water).
Apply mixed solution on both sides of the finished stencil with a soft brush or sponge.
Ensure that both sides of the screen are completely treated.
Use a fan or allow to air-dry placing it in a drying cabinet.
Ensure that the entire stencil area is thoroughly dry before use.
Instruction for use
Stencils that have been treated with Hardener Patly A : Hardener Patly B will be more difficult to remove and will require the use of a high pressure gun after decoating with Screenstrip.

GENERAL INFORMATION
Hardener Patly A and B should be stored in a cool dry place at 0-35 ํC.
Hardener Patly A and B can be stored for 24 months.
This product is not stable when exposed to freezing temperatures and will not be shipped during such conditions.
